Hi Libby,
I don't have exact prices for the Knebworth and Woburn ones as I'm waiting for some info, but I did the one at Knebworth 2 years ago and that cost about £200. I expect they would be around the same mark. It sounds a lot but these fairs do draw an awful lot of people, especially before Christmas. You get a couple of tables and electricity and although there is some lighting, I would recommend you bring your own spot lighting as well.
If you do decide to go, though, I'd recommend you also bring a good lot of smaller, inexpensive items for the "just looking" crowd.
The Highfield School one costs £24.00 for a large table, £18 for a medium-sized table and £12 for a small table. You can also request a backboard and electricity at no extra cost if you need it. Set-up is from 8.00 a.m. I've booked for that one already.
